    Job DescriptionJob Description

    About Us:
    Stenger & Stenger, founded in 1994 in Grand Rapids, MI, is a fast-growing, dynamic law firm specializing in creditors’ rights across 11 states. Our mission is to provide the highest quality legal services while ensuring fair and compassionate resolutions for consumers. Our success is driven by the highly effective use of legal remedies by dedicated and motivated team members. The firm offers a friendly, fast-paced work environment and is committed to facilitating professional growth for top talent in our collaborative, supportive, and technology-driven workplace. Our vision of setting the bar together through compliant, effective legal collections is done through our core values of:

    Hard WorkInnovationTeamworkPerformanceExcellence


    About the Role:

    The Paralegal position based in our Grand Rapids, MI office plays a critical role in supporting our legal team by managing a wide range of legal and administrative tasks. This role is essential to the team and responsible for assisting and supporting their state attorneys in his/her duties by performing paralegal and administrative duties. Team members frequently communicate and collaborate with other legal team members including attorneys, county clerks, judges, and consumer’s places of employment

    Minimum Qualifications:

    Associate’s degree or paralegal certificate from an accredited institution.Minimum of 2 years of experience working as a paralegal or in a similar legal support role.Basic knowledge of Microsoft Office.Strong knowledge of legal terminology, procedures, and documentation standards.Excellent written and verbal communication skills.1-3 years' experience in creditor's rights and civil litigation preferred

    Responsibilities:

    Prompt response and execution of instruction from state attorney, direct supervisor, secondary supervisor, Collections Manager, Client Relations Manager, Director of Compliance, Director of Operations, and/or President.Assist state attorney/paralegal supervisor in the maintenance of account files.Assist state attorney in drafting documents and legal pleadings.Assist state attorney/paralegal supervisor in file maintenance by updating the case files with court/vendor information.Review drafted correspondences/pleadings, assemble documentation, redact and assemble case exhibits.

    About the Role:
    We are seeking an Attorney, licensed and located in Michigan (near Grand Rapids), to join our growing team in retail consumer collections. If you enjoy working on a team in a fast-paced environment and have an interest in leveraging the latest in technology, the firm could be a good fit for you. The ideal candidate will have 1-3 years of experience in creditor’s rights and civil litigation and be eager to contribute to all aspects of file generation and litigation. This position, which reports to our state lead, is best suited for quick learning, dependable, and collaborative attorneys. As a key member of our team, you will:

    Use your Juris Doctorate degree, analytical mindset, and knowledge of laws and regulations applicable to creditor’s rights and collections to develop and implement case-level litigation strategy, and zealously represent clients at court proceedings Have a high bar for excellence, a sense of urgency, and advanced interpersonal and written communication skills to partner with our internal team of attorneys, paralegals, and support staff to efficiently manage dockets and cases, prepare pleadings, and ensure seamless case management Use your good judgement, complex problem-solving skills, and achievement orientation to negotiate settlements with defendants and opposing counsel, defend against counterclaims, and navigate escalated litigation matters to resolve disputes. Be adept in leveraging the latest industry technology, monitoring and educating team members on changes to laws or regulations, and support continuous improvement by identifying opportunities for increased efficiencyEnjoy regional travel to appear at courts throughout Michigan, have a good standing with the Michigan Bar Association, and be able to meet requirements of our thorough background review process
